Had this on tap at The Lackman in OTR. The smell has that raw, creamed corn and hay smell. Reminds me of when I did a sour wort Berliner, and this beer was very reminiscent from the smell that came out of the fermenter. Lots of lacto sourness in the taste. Lemony, spritzy (duh!) and zero bittering units from what I can detect. A very raw, grainy flavor, almost barn-yardy. I'm guessing this was a no-boil Berliner? A pretty good one though, and glad I tried it! Very true to the style
